We are looking for a UI Lead Developer with a strong background in React.js and front-end architecture to lead the development of cutting-edge user interfaces. The ideal candidate should be well-versed in modern front-end frameworks and capable of developing responsive, high-performance web applications that communicate effectively with backend systems, and exposure to AI-powered tools.
Requirements
- Minimum 5 years of experience in front-end development, with strong expertise in React.js and modern JavaScript.
- Deep understanding of component-based architecture and state management libraries (Redux, Context API, etc.).
- Experience with frontend build tools (Webpack, Babel, Vite), REST APIs, and CI/CD pipeline.
- Solid experience in API integration (REST/GraphQL) and handling asynchronous data flow (Axios, Fetch, etc.).
- Exposure to AI-driven code editors (e.g., GitHub Copilot, TabNine, CodeWhisperer) or similar tooling.
- Hands-on experience with Service Workers for enabling application offline capability and progressive web app (PWA) features.
- Excellent problem-solving and communication skills.
- Background in mentoring or leading UI teams in agile environments.
Benefits
- Competitive compensation
- Flexible work options